Output afc23498b142a1ca98f8226623f794fba7013f6a1db39e10c7852087102dba34:4

value
77189094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66ce99ff129ed652d50e460fd80a5726ade27598 OP_EQUAL
address
3B4cM394NRXKkboXTfpbjtQFPomWvn8jFD
transaction
afc23498b142a1ca98f8226623f794fba7013f6a1db39e10c7852087102dba34
spent
true